Tips For Protecting Intellectual Property

YoungUpstarts

Have Employees Sign Non-Disclosures. If you work with a team or have employees, it is important to have them sign non-disclosure agreements to cover the security of your intellectual property. Obtain assistance to have the non-disclosures well-written to keep your ideas safe from being taken.

The Ultimate Inventor’s Guide to Inventing Things

Up and Running

If you want to explain your idea to someone in-depth and are worried potential theft, you can get them to sign a non-disclosure agreement (NDA)—a legal document that states both parties intent to keep information confidential.
